However, for some people who are retired, the lack of routine and not working is actually something that they really struggle with, and therefore if this is the same for you, there are lots of things that you can do to recreate that.

If you want to continue working and just want to work fewer hours, find a part time job that you can do. This may be an opportunity to learn new skills and work in an entirely different job role. There are lots of jobs that are well suited to retired people, and you will be far from the only one – there are lots of retirees who want to remain an active part of the workforce and it can be good for your health to keep that energy and momentum.

There is also the option to do volunteering. There are many different voluntary roles, from working in a charity shop to volunteering with those in need such as helping homeless people or working in an animal shelter. Have a look for charitable groups around your area who are always on the lookout for volunteers and think of the skills that you have and the things that you are passionate about to help you choose a volunteering role that you are likely to enjoy.

Some of the most valued volunteers by many charitable organisations are retired people who give up their time to help with a good cause. You will also have the opportunity to make new friends and get involved in your local community too.
